Andrew Western vs Calum Miller

A side-by-side comparison of voting participation, party rebellion, topic focus, and recent voting overlap.


Voting alignment

Andrew Western and Calum Miller voted the same way 15% of the time, based on 318 shared comparable votes.

49 same votes 269 different votes 318 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
